Leading Wealth Creators ₹1,000 Cr+
India's wealth leaders individuals who have crossed the ₹1,000 crore mark in personal net worth. This group spans first-generation founders who built from nothing, legacy inheritors who scaled family enterprises across multiple sectors, and executives whose operational leadership translated into significant equity. Together they represent every path through which significant wealth is created and compounded in India.

Top 100 Families
India’s Most Powerful Business Dynasties
The 100 most powerful business families in India collectively control ₹76.5 lakh crore. The top ten families account for 49% of that total—a concentration so significant that their capital allocation decisions reshape the financing environment for entire sectors. These families are not passive holders. They are the active architects of Indian capitalism, building across generations, reinventing across cycles, and compounding across decades.
Emerging Wealth Creators ₹425–1,000 Cr
India's next tier of wealth creators holds between ₹425 crore and ₹1,000 crore in personal net worth. They include founders in their first compounding cycle, inheritors beginning to expand beyond the core family business, and digital-first entrepreneurs whose enterprises are still early in realising their full value. These are the names that will define the leading tier in the next edition of this list.
